How To Fix CO159 - Select


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CO - PPC order processing messages

  • Message number: 159

  • Message text: Select

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message CO159 - Select ?

    The SAP error message CO159 typically occurs in the context of controlling (CO) and can be related to various issues, often involving the selection of cost objects or cost centers. The specific message may vary based on the context in which it appears, but it generally indicates that a selection criterion is not met or that the system cannot find the required data.

    Cause:

    1. Invalid Selection Criteria: The selection criteria you have entered may not match any existing records in the database.
    2.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or select the specified cost objects or cost centers.
    3. Data Not Available: The data you are trying to access may not exist for the specified period or may have been archived.
    4.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the controlling module that are not set up correctly.

    Solution:

    1. Check Selection Criteria: Review the selection criteria you have entered to ensure they are correct and that they correspond to existing records.
    2. Verify Authorizations: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to access the data. You may need to contact your SAP security administrator to check your user roles.
    3. Data Availability: Check if the data you are trying to access is available for the specified period. If the data has been archived, you may need to retrieve it from the archive.
    4. Configuration Review: If you suspect a configuration issue, consult with your SAP functional consultant to review the settings in the controlling module.
    5. Use Alternative Selection Methods: If the standard selection method is not working, try using alternative methods or reports to access the required data.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es in the CO module, such as KSB1 (Cost Centers: Actual Line Items) or KOB1 (Orders: Actual Line Items).
    • SAP Notes: Check SAP Notes for any known issues or patches related to the error message CO159.
    •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help files for more detailed information on the controlling module and how to troubleshoot selection issues.
